云渲染期间本地设备能否关闭?技术原理与操作指南

一、云渲染的核心技术架构解析

云渲染的本质是将本地3D渲染任务卸载至云端高性能计算集群执行,其技术架构包含三层核心组件:

  1. 客户端层:用户通过本地客户端提交渲染任务,包括场景文件、材质参数、光照配置等数据。此阶段需保持网络连接以完成数据上传。
  2. 云服务层:云端接收任务后,由调度系统分配至空闲GPU节点执行渲染计算,实时生成帧序列并存储于对象存储服务。
  3. 结果回传层:渲染完成后,系统将结果压缩打包并通过安全通道回传至用户本地设备,或提供在线预览链接。

从技术实现看,本地设备仅在任务提交和结果接收阶段需要保持在线。渲染计算过程完全由云端独立完成,理论上本地设备可断开连接。

二、本地设备关闭的可行性分析

(一)支持离线渲染的服务模式

主流云渲染平台提供两种任务提交方式:

  • 同步模式:用户实时监控渲染进度,需保持本地客户端在线。
  • 异步模式:任务提交后生成唯一任务ID,用户可关闭本地设备,通过网页端或API查询进度。

典型场景示例

  1. # 伪代码:异步任务提交示例
  2. def submit_async_render(scene_path):
  3. task_id = cloud_api.upload_scene(scene_path)
  4. print(f"任务ID: {task_id}, 进度查询URL: https://cloud-render.com/tasks/{task_id}")
  5. return task_id

用户提交任务后即可关闭本地设备,后续通过浏览器访问进度页面。

(二)数据完整性保障机制

为防止网络中断导致任务丢失,云渲染系统采用多重保障:

  1. 断点续传:文件上传过程支持校验和断点恢复。
  2. 任务持久化:云端数据库实时记录任务状态,即使节点故障也可快速恢复。
  3. 结果缓存:渲染完成的帧序列在云端保存72小时,用户可随时下载。

三、操作建议与风险规避

(一)推荐操作流程

  1. 任务提交阶段

    • 使用异步模式提交任务
    • 确认任务ID和查询URL已保存
    • 检查网络连接稳定性(建议使用有线网络)
  2. 设备关闭阶段

    • 关闭本地渲染客户端
    • 保持路由器/调制解调器供电(若需接收结果)
    • 记录任务ID至云端笔记服务
  3. 结果获取阶段

    • 通过网页端查看进度条
    • 渲染完成后选择分块下载(大文件建议使用IDM等工具)
    • 立即备份结果至本地存储

(二)需避免的操作

  1. 同步模式关闭设备:将导致任务中断且无法恢复
  2. 未保存任务ID:失去进度追踪能力
  3. 使用公共Wi-Fi:网络波动可能影响结果回传

四、性能优化与成本控制

(一)资源释放策略

  • 按需计费模式:任务完成后立即释放GPU资源,避免持续计费
  • 自动关机设置:部分平台支持渲染完成后自动关闭云端实例

(二)网络优化技巧

  1. 分时段上传:避开网络高峰期(如晚间20:00-22:00)
  2. 压缩场景文件:使用.zip或.rar格式减少传输时间
  3. 启用QoS:在路由器中为云渲染流量设置高优先级

五、典型问题解决方案

问题1:关闭设备后进度停滞

可能原因

  • 云端计算节点故障
  • 存储系统负载过高

解决方案

  1. 通过任务ID联系技术支持
  2. 手动重启任务(部分平台支持)
  3. 切换至备用云服务商

问题2:结果文件损坏

预防措施

  • 渲染前勾选”生成校验文件”选项
  • 下载时使用MD5校验
  • 分段下载大文件(如每1000帧一个包)

六、行业实践参考

根据对主流云服务商的调研,90%以上的长周期渲染任务(超过4小时)采用异步模式。某动画工作室案例显示,通过合理使用异步渲染,设备空转时间减少78%,电费成本下降65%。建议企业用户建立标准化操作流程:

  1. 指定专人负责任务监控
  2. 制定《云渲染设备管理规范》
  3. 每月进行任务完成率统计

云渲染技术的成熟度已支持本地设备在任务提交后安全关闭。用户需重点关注任务模式选择、数据完整性保障和异常处理机制。通过规范化的操作流程,既能充分利用云端算力,又可降低本地设备运维成本。建议首次使用异步模式的用户先进行短周期任务测试,逐步建立操作信心。